Which Kinds of Sustainable Roofing Materials Do Eco-Friendly Contractors Use?Eco-friendly roofing contractors emphasize the use of sustainable materials that reduce environmental impact and deliver long-lasting performance. Some of the most popular materials include recycled shingles produced from reclaimed products, which keep waste from landfills and curb resource consumption. Eco shingles manufactured using toxin-free materials and low-impact processes represent an ideal alternative to conventional asphalt shingles.

Metal roofing is another preferred choice due to its remarkable durability, recyclability, and resistance to wind and weather elements. Bamboo roofing offers a rapidly renewable option, leveraging fast-growing natural resources with minimal environmental strain. In addition, biodegradable membranes and organic roof treatments curb the introduction of harmful chemicals, promoting healthier ecosystems.

Natural insulation materials such as sheep wool or cellulose improve thermal insulation, assisting to regulate indoor temperatures properly. Contractors ensure all materials are sustainably sourced, highlighting durability and lifecycle analysis to maximize longevity and environmental benefits.

How Are Solar Panels and Solar Shingles Incorporated into Green Roofing Solutions?

Integrating renewable energy technologies like solar panels and solar shingles is a distinct aspect of advanced eco-friendly roofing contractors. Solar panels can be fixed on current or new roofs to harvest clean, renewable energy, dramatically reducing consumption on fossil fuels and reducing electricity bills.

What Are Green Roofing and Living Roof Systems, and What Benefits Do They Provide?Green roofing, also known as living roofs, includes installing layers of vegetation on rooftops to create ecosystems that deliver numerous environmental and practical benefits. These roofs are often designed using permaculture principles to encourage biodiversity and sustainable water management.

Living roofs naturally absorb rainwater, aiding water conservation and alleviating water runoff problems that lead to urban flooding. The soil and plants offer excellent thermal insulation, decreasing heating and cooling demands while increasing indoor comfort.

They also play a vital role in moisture control, air purification, and noise reduction. Proper design ensures effective drainage and ventilation, reducing structural issues and increasing roof lifespan.

In What Ways Do Eco-Friendly Coatings and Sealants Enhance Roof Performance?Employing eco-friendly coatings and sealants is crucial in boosting a roof’s performance while protecting the environment. Low VOC coatings emit fewer toxic substances, supporting healthy healthy indoor and outdoor air quality.

Reflective coatings, often certified under Energy Star programs, send sunlight away from roofs, lowering heat absorption and decreasing air conditioning costs. These “cool roofs” aid in diminishing heat in urban heat islands.

Non-toxic sealants protect roof integrity without letting off toxic compounds. Additional treatments such as shingles resistant to algae and moss management block biological buildup that can deteriorate roofing materials over time. Some coatings also improve natural daylighting, generating brighter and healthier interior spaces.

How Do Roofing Contractors Promote Sustainable Construction and Responsible Disposal?Sustainable construction practices are fundamental to eco-friendly roofing contractors’ standards. They emphasize minimizing waste, recycling old roofing materials, and sourcing sustainable products from established suppliers.

Roof recycling efforts channel significant amounts of debris from landfills by reclaiming metal, wood, and asphalt materials where possible. Contractors implement lifecycle analysis to examine the environmental impact of materials and processes, striving to lower the overall carbon footprint of roofing projects.

Many contractors acquire and keep certifications such as LEED or other green building credentials to show compliance with rigorous environmental standards and maintain accountability.

What Role Does Water Runoff Management Have in Eco-Friendly Roofing?Effective water runoff management is a key element in sustainable roofing, stopping soil erosion and reducing strain on municipal stormwater systems.

Eco-friendly gutters and rainwater harvesting systems collect and reuse rainwater, which aids landscaping needs and saves water. These features improve living roofs and permeable surfaces to control moisture responsibly.

Proper water runoff strategies improve the durability of roofing materials by reducing water accumulation and potential leaks.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q1: What defines a roofing contractor "eco-friendly"?A roofing contractor obtains the eco-friendly label by working with sustainable materials, employing energy-efficient installation techniques, limiting waste, and complying with green building standards such as LEED.

Q2: Are eco-friendly roofing materials more high-priced than traditional ones?While initial investment might be higher, eco-friendly materials bring long-term savings through enhanced durability, energy efficiency, and eligibility for tax credits and rebates.

Q3: How long do green roofs remain effective compared to conventional roofs?Green roofs often outlast conventional roofs due to protective plant layers that safeguard roofing materials from ultraviolet rays and harsh weather, potentially lasting 40 years or more.

Q4: Can I add solar panels to an existing roof?Yes, solar panels are typically compatible with existing roofs; however, solar shingles are best mounted during new roof construction to secure proper integration.

Q5: Are there maintenance requirements for living roofs?Living roofs need routine maintenance, including irrigation checks, trimming vegetation, and inspecting drainage systems to maintain optimal health and function.

Q6: Do eco-friendly roofs receive government rebates or tax credits?Many sustainable roofing improvements can receive federal, state, or local incentives, though eligibility varies with the specific technology and location.
